Explore the impact of CVE-2023-34468 on Apache NiFi, allowing potential code injection through database services using H2 driver. Learn mitigation steps and preventive measures.
A detailed overview of CVE-2023-34468, a vulnerability affecting Apache NiFi that allows code execution through database services using H2 driver.
Understanding CVE-2023-34468
This section provides insights into the nature and impact of the CVE-2023-34468 vulnerability.
What is CVE-2023-34468?
The vulnerability in Apache NiFi versions 0.0.2 through 1.21.0 allows an authenticated user to configure a Database URL with the H2 driver, leading to code execution.
The Impact of CVE-2023-34468
CVE-2023-34468 has the potential to allow malicious actors to execute custom code, posing a significant security risk to affected systems.
Technical Details of CVE-2023-34468
Explore the technical aspects and implications of the CVE-2023-34468 vulnerability.
Vulnerability Description
The DBCPConnectionPool and HikariCPConnectionPool Controller Services in Apache NiFi enable users to configure a Database URL with the H2 driver, facilitating code execution.
Affected Systems and Versions
Apache NiFi versions 0.0.2 through 1.21.0 are impacted by this vulnerability, providing an avenue for unauthorized code execution.
Exploitation Mechanism
An authenticated and authorized user can exploit this vulnerability by configuring the Database URL with the H2 driver, enabling custom code execution.
Mitigation and Prevention
Learn about the steps to mitigate the risks associated with CVE-2023-34468 and secure vulnerable systems.
Immediate Steps to Take
Users are advised to upgrade to Apache NiFi version 1.22.0 or later to mitigate the CVE-2023-34468 vulnerability and prevent code execution.
Long-Term Security Practices
Implement strict access controls, regular security audits, and monitoring mechanisms to enhance the overall security posture of Apache NiFi deployments.
Patching and Updates
Stay informed about security patches and updates released by Apache Software Foundation to address vulnerabilities like CVE-2023-34468 and ensure timely application to safeguard systems.